About The Position

The Lab Support Technician is part of the provider care team acting in a support capacity for reports, data and scheduling functions of the laboratory. This position is responsible for accurate, timely and effective provision of laboratory support mechanisms. The Lab Support Technician will be required to exhibit excellent customer service skills in line with the Mercy Signature Service Standards with all customer interactions. The Lab Support Technician is responsible for the skillful acquisition of all required types of specimens, as required, for laboratory testing utilizing safe, accurate, effective, professional methodologies while observing HIPAA confidentiality requirements and lab policies. Performs duties and responsibilities in a manner consistent with our mission, values, and Mercy Service Standards.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• 6 months phlebotomy or clinical laboratory experience or successful completion of a clinical training program.
  • Satisfactorily complete specific facility competencies, including but not limited to checklist, written examination, management observation, etc., to be eligible for advancement.
